For a successful clash of patterns, you need to have the exact color used as the base of both patterns. For instance, if you own an upholstered plaid cushion and one with flowers, make sure that they have the same colors or even the same block colour to ensure it will work.
Sofas can be among the most costly furniture pieces you can purchase So, instead of shelling out thousands, give your sofa that is old and worn an overhaul instead. Find a clean, moist hand towel. It should only be a bit damp but not dripping. Clean the surface of the sofa with the towel, and you’ll see a shocking quantity of dust and lint get off. Take your hand steamer from the big-box stores for around $20 and steam the couch. Steam will release wrinkles and help kill bugs and bacteria. Additionally, it will make the fabric appear newer.

With the trend for organic minimalist growing ever-popular and a lot of people are looking for the chic look of wood panels for that sophisticated appearance. My client was an apartment tenant who was unable to paint and having wood panels would have cost a lot. However, I used an innovative trick! I found peel and stick wallpaper with the pattern of a wood panel on it. I hung it over my client’s bed and the change was dramatic. Instantly, it brought warmth and texture to the space. The vertical lines made the ceiling appear to be twice as high. Take a look at my IG Reel from the spacehere. The peel-and-stick wallpaper was easy to install. It took just three hours and cost a couple of hundred dollars. The great thing is, when you have to leave, or perhaps you feel like a new look just take the wallpaper off the walls. It is crucial to follow the guidelines of the manufacturer and check the wall prior to applying the wallpaper.
